Your patient is a 39-year-old man who just had extensive surgery to repair torn ligaments in his shoulder. The physician has cleared him for passive range of motion exercises. He is in a great deal of pain and is fearful of moving the shoulder. Which of the following instructions would be the best instruction to give the patient during the passive range of motion activities?


A) Instruct him to close his eyes and attend to how the movement feels.
B) Instruct him to close his eyes and focus on a distracting thought.
C) Instruct him to watch the movement and pay attention to how it feels.
D) Instruct him to watch the movement and focus on a distracting thought.
